Overview of Rhinospray
Quick Facts
| Property | Description |
|---|---|
| Active ingredient | Tramazoline hydrochloride |
| Form | Nasal solution / Nasal spray |
| Pharmacological class | Sympathomimetic Alpha-Adrenergic Agonist |
| Common use | Alleviating nasal congestion |
| Origin | Synthetic (Imidazoline derivative) |
What Type of Medicine is Rhinospray?
Rhinospray is defined as a synthetic nasal decongestant medication, recognized for its ability to relieve the physical symptom of a blocked or stuffy nose. The active substance, Tramazoline hydrochloride, is classified as an alpha-sympathomimetic agent. This classification places it in the therapeutic group of vasoconstrictors that act locally on the adrenergic receptors within the nasal lining, a property that is utilized for rapid local relief. Tramazoline is chemically recognized as an imidazoline derivative, a compound type specifically developed for effective topical action. The drug is often positioned for fast, direct relief of acute symptoms, such as those resulting from the common cold, distinguishing its focus from systemic treatments or chronic nasal issues.
Composition and Form: The Role of Tramazoline
The core component is the active ingredient, Tramazoline hydrochloride. Rhinospray is formulated as a nasal solution or nasal spray, specifically intended for topical intranasal administration. This is an important differentiating factor, as topical delivery provides direct action at the site of congestion. The preparation is typically an aqueous solution—a water-based vehicle—allowing the active substance to be efficiently dispersed and absorbed locally on the nasal lining. The product is commonly available as a single active ingredient preparation, though specific variants may include components like essential oils to address secondary symptoms or patient preferences.
What is the General Purpose of Rhinospray?
The general purpose of Rhinospray is to provide rapid, localized relief by causing vasoconstriction, or the narrowing of small blood vessels within the nasal tissues. This physiological action immediately reduces the excessive blood flow and fluid buildup that characterize the inflammation and swelling of the nasal mucosa. By diminishing the swelling, the medication physically opens the nasal passages, directly alleviating the symptom of a blocked nose and restoring comfortable nasal airflow.
